FAQs

Q1 : What role do university libraries play in academic excellence?

University libraries are instrumental in academic excellence by providing a wide range of resources, offering a peaceful environment for learning, and promoting essential skills.

Q2: What resources can I find in a university library that contribute to academic success?

University libraries offer an extensive collection of books, e-books, research materials, and digital archives, all of which are valuable for research and study.

Q3: How do university librarians support students’ academic journeys?

Librarians are more than bookkeepers; they serve as mentors, guiding students in research, citation, and information literacy, thereby enhancing their academic skills.

Q4 : What skills can I develop by using university library resources?

Students can hone skills such as critical thinking, research, data analysis, and technology proficiency, which are crucial not only for academic success but also for future careers.

Q 5 : Are university libraries only for individual study, or do they encourage collaboration?

Modern university libraries have evolved to promote collaboration, with group study spaces and discussion areas that facilitate the exchange of ideas among students.
